The brass vent port on the right side carb on California specific carbs had a pipe that ran somewhere??? Either to the smog cannister mounted by the radiator shroud or to the bottom of the fuel tank where there is another vent. I'll be using these carbs on my current build.

What do you do with this vent port when not using it? Can it be capped off or does it need to keep "venting"?





Found an old photo but still don't know where the other end terminates.

Just a follow up here. I have 2 real life examples of people that capped off that California only vent port. I will cap it off.

Striker, it does not go to the power valve. I'm 99% sure it went to the carbon canister in addition to the California only fuel tank vent pipe.
